diff --git a/lazy-lock.json b/lazy-lock.json index 6e2a44e..b920146 100644 --- a/lazy-lock.json +++ b/lazy-lock.json @@ -2,8 +2,9 @@ "LazyVim": { "branch": "main", "commit": "fb1f29c32c516601b4074d113202482769ef030e" }, "LuaSnip": { "branch": "master", "commit": "0b4950a237ce441a6a3a947d501622453f6860ea" }, "alpha-nvim": { "branch": "main", "commit": "e4fc5e29b731bdf55d204c5c6a11dc3be70f3b65" }, + "aurora": { "branch": "master", "commit": "7a3ea3e6747ddd1acbe898e0b4193213aba36b86" }, "bufferline.nvim": { "branch": "main", "commit": "d24378edc14a675c820a303b4512af3bbc5761e9" }, - "catppuccin": { "branch": "main", "commit": "a84ee1848bfac4601771805396552bdbaa0a0e91" }, + "catppuccin": { "branch": "main", "commit": "a96334d46f5cc6c5d196585a85ebc863327a331c" }, "cmp-buffer": { "branch": "main", "commit": "3022dbc9166796b644a841a02de8dd1cc1d311fa" }, "cmp-nvim-lsp": { "branch": "main", "commit": "44b16d11215dce86f253ce0c30949813c0a90765" }, "cmp-path": { "branch": "main", "commit": "91ff86cd9c29299a64f968ebb45846c485725f23" }, @@ -14,8 +15,11 @@ "friendly-snippets": { "branch": "main", "commit": "ea84a710262cb2c286d439070bad37d36fd3db25" }, "gitsigns.nvim": { "branch": "main", "commit": "adcf2c7f2f495f5df148683764bf7cba6a70f34c" }, "indent-blankline.nvim": { "branch": "master", "commit": "4541d690816cb99a7fc248f1486aa87f3abce91c" }, + "kanagawa.nvim": { "branch": "master", "commit": "1749cea392acb7d1548a946fcee1e6f1304cd3cb" }, + "komau.vim": { "branch": "master", "commit": "759adf8a6b3daa57c5f9229e241968e401e4ac4c" }, "lazy.nvim": { "branch": "main", "commit": "14d76aac4bd3ff07c1fca074c210f28f766a931e" }, "lualine.nvim": { "branch": "master", "commit": "05d78e9fd0cdfb4545974a5aa14b1be95a86e9c9" }, + "lush.nvim": { "branch": "main", "commit": "b10ef2bfff0647e701b691019ade3edd5e44eb50" }, "mason-lspconfig.nvim": { "branch": "main", "commit": "828a538ac8419f586c010996aefa5df6eb7c250b" }, "mason.nvim": { "branch": "main", "commit": "5ad3e113b0c3fde3caba8630599373046f6197e8" }, "mini.ai": { "branch": "main", "commit": "5218ea75e635df78a807bc9d5a7162594fb76d02" }, @@ -28,11 +32,11 @@ "neoconf.nvim": { "branch": "main", "commit": "08f146d53e075055500dca35e93281faff95716b" }, "neodev.nvim": { "branch": "main", "commit": "62515f64dfb196e8abe1263e17e2546559e41292" }, "neorg": { "branch": "main", "commit": "774f5dd80d15aa11d0221aba767da699f9533e32" }, - "noice.nvim": { "branch": "main", "commit": "dba8ac8e1239f541df1bba7d177eb09e51262ac4" }, - "nui.nvim": { "branch": "main", "commit": "d146966a423e60699b084eeb28489fe3b6427599" }, + "noice.nvim": { "branch": "main", "commit": "c0917d2775b0d77b0297af16936aaf96abb678ac" }, + "nui.nvim": { "branch": "main", "commit": "9e3916e784660f55f47daa6f26053ad044db5d6a" }, "null-ls.nvim": { "branch": "main", "commit": "db09b6c691def0038c456551e4e2772186449f35" }, "nvim-cmp": { "branch": "main", "commit": "c4e491a87eeacf0408902c32f031d802c7eafce8" }, - "nvim-lspconfig": { "branch": "master", "commit": "447443a2404adc323ad2efc7c0a346a904ce694c" }, + "nvim-lspconfig": { "branch": "master", "commit": "443c56a0cc67aad932c49d0b4a814d3014a3732f" }, "nvim-navic": { "branch": "master", "commit": "e6da6f74d89de65258ea7e98e22103ff5de6dcf5" }, "nvim-notify": { "branch": "master", "commit": "ea9c8ce7a37f2238f934e087c255758659948e0f" }, "nvim-spectre": { "branch": "master", "commit": "1ef252c1bf569b88e7e2fafde1eb0861d4f06aa3" }, @@ -43,6 +47,8 @@ "orgmode": { "branch": "master", "commit": "6f73b461b9f887968d0f69ab3aee6b4ceebe3445" }, "persistence.nvim": { "branch": "main", "commit": "4b8051c01f696d8849a5cb8afa9767be8db16e40" }, "plenary.nvim": { "branch": "master", "commit": "267282a9ce242bbb0c5dc31445b6d353bed978bb" }, + "rasmus.nvim": { "branch": "main", "commit": "f824de95d446686e479781c0c2b778c177da528f" }, + "styler.nvim": { "branch": "main", "commit": "d5b7e43af4fdaa06e4175c84f4f57b633ae7e6ff" }, "symbols-outline.nvim": { "branch": "master", "commit": "512791925d57a61c545bc303356e8a8f7869763c" }, "telescope.nvim": { "branch": "master", "commit": "47c755d737702df7a39b640c8d9c473a728be1df" }, "tmux.nvim": { "branch": "main", "commit": "03e28fdaa2ef54b975ba1930f1e69b5e231dedc9" }, diff --git a/lua/plugins/colors.lua b/lua/plugins/colors.lua new file mode 100644 index 0000000..428e2a7 --- /dev/null +++ b/lua/plugins/colors.lua @@ -0,0 +1,19 @@ +return { + { "rebelot/kanagawa.nvim" }, + { "rktjmp/lush.nvim" }, + { "kvrohit/rasmus.nvim" }, + { "ntk148v/komau.vim" }, + { "ray-x/aurora" }, + { + "folke/styler.nvim", + config = function() + require("styler").setup({ + themes = { + markdown = { colorscheme = "rasmus" }, + help = { colorscheme = "catppuccin-mocha", background = "dark" }, + elixir = { colorscheme = "kanagawa" }, + }, + }) + end, + }, +} diff --git a/lua/plugins/elixir-tools.lua b/lua/plugins/elixir-tools.lua index 94e1f63..a81fee2 100644 --- a/lua/plugins/elixir-tools.lua +++ b/lua/plugins/elixir-tools.lua @@ -15,7 +15,7 @@ return { dialyzerEnabled = false, enableTestLenses = false, }), - on_attach = function(client, bufnr) + on_attach = function(_, _) vim.keymap.set("n", "fp", ":ElixirFromPipe", { buffer = true, noremap = true }) vim.keymap.set("n", "tp", ":ElixirToPipe", { buffer = true, noremap = true }) vim.keymap.set("v", "em", ":ElixirExpandMacro", { buffer = true, noremap = true }) diff --git a/lua/plugins/treesitter.lua b/lua/plugins/treesitter.lua index 9d932d9..2f6b377 100644 --- a/lua/plugins/treesitter.lua +++ b/lua/plugins/treesitter.lua @@ -27,41 +27,51 @@ return { ensure_installed = { "bash", "c", + "clojure", + "comment", + "commonlisp", + "cpp", + "eex", + --"elisp", + "elixir", + "erlang", + "go", + "haskell", "html", + "java", "javascript", "json", + "kotlin", + "latex", + "ledger", + "ledger", "lua", "luadoc", "luap", "markdown", "markdown_inline", + "nix", + "ocaml", + "org", + "perl", + "php", + "phpdoc", "python", "query", "regex", + "ruby", + "rust", + "scala", + "scala", + "scheme", + "sql", "tsx", "typescript", "vim", "vimdoc", "yaml", - "elixir", - "erlang", - "go", - "rust", - "ruby", - "ocaml", - "perl", - "java", - "haskell", - "org", - "nix", - "scala", - "scheme", - "latex", - "elisp", - "clojure", - "cpp", - "comment", - "sql", + "yaml", + "zig", }, incremental_selection = { enable = true,